Ronald "Ron" Dennislee Davis
March 6th, 1994 - February 18th, 2025
It broke my heart to lose you, But you didn't go alone, For part of me went with you, The day God called you home. Those we love don't go away, They walk beside us every day, Unseen, unheard, but always near, Still loved, still missed, and very dear
Ronald Dennislee Davis, aged 30, passed away on February 18, 2025, in Las Vegas, Nevada. Born on March 6, 1994, Ronald was known as one of the most genuine people, always bringing sincerity and warmth into the lives of those around him.
He is survived by his son, Ronald Davis Jr.; mother, Ronette Miller; siblings, Kimesha Davis, Boris Davis Jr., and Ashley Davis; and brother, Alonzo Hampton. Ronald was preceded in death by his father, Boris Davis Sr.; niece, Lyric Hampton; and brother, Dulondo Hampton Jr.
Ronald was a devoted family man, cherishing time spent with loved ones and engaging in family activities, which were his primary hobby. His presence brought joy and togetherness to his family, creating cherished memories that will live on through his relatives and friends.
Cremation services were conducted on April 2, 2025. Ronald's life and legacy will be remembered by all who knew him as a beacon of genuine kindness and familial devotion.
